    Spiderbox/Smartbox HD600 Patch 06/08/2013

    First Save your channel list .
    Put wireless (wifi) off - Your lines off .
    Download patch .
    Factory Settings .
    Download your channel list



    Improvements !!!

    1)Improved Audio Quality through HDMI connection.

    2)Pressing Audio button from remote added Channel Audio Level option from 1 to 15 to increase each channel's volume .

    3)Sort option removed for now due to permanent saving.
    For anybody want it ,it still exists in Menu - TV Channel Editor - Edit - Sort

    4)Menu - Software Update : OTA option removed
